My name’s Felicia and I’m a 12-stepper turned therapist. I’m married and I have two littles under 5. I grew up in church but I didn’t find Jesus or understand grace until I found the rooms of AA in 2011. I love Jesus but have had my fair share of struggling with church culture and religion. I know what it’s like to be stuck in a restless, irritable, and discontent rut (drunk & sober). This next season I’m going to be shifting the podcast focus to stories of hope for sober living. This change comes after a year of podcasting and recognizing more than ever the power of storytelling and my hope to reach a larger audience of listeners seeking a solution to their addiction in addition to solutions for living sober. There will still at times be a focus on reaching parents in recovery since this is such a huge part of my recovery, but not all my guests who will be sharing their experience, strength, and hope, will be parents.
